Equipment Engineer-Implant

Experience TSMC Washington where technology leaders are constantly innovating, manufacturing to perfection, and collaborating with customers to achieve greatness. Witness the action-packed team in motion as they strive to maintain their position at the forefront of the industry. 

 

As an Implant Equipment Engineer, you are responsible for the tool troubleshooting and productivity/particle/cost improvement, which includes AMAT Quantum, VIIsion80 High Current Implanters, E500 Medium Current Implanters and Axcelis High Energy Implanters. Equipment Engineer is also in charge of PM checklist and SOP for technicians to follow. TSMC WA is a fast-paced semiconductor-manufacturing environment offering a variety of challenges.  Responsibilities include: 

  • Work closely with Manufacturing, Module Engineers and other Technicians to improve the overall area/tool performance and meet quality and manufacturing goals.

  • Will work on AMAT Quantum/VIIsion80 High Current Implanters, E500 Medium Current Implanters and Axcelis High Energy Implanters as a tool owner.
  • Responsible for continuous improvement in Productivity, Particle and Cost, as well as Scrap Reduction.
  • Highly self-motivated to initiate actions and solutions to prevent occurrence of any tool abnormal events.
  • Interact with Process Engineers and MFG group to perform tool improvement or event prevention.
  • Requires working in a clean room environment.

 

Requirements: 

  • All applicants must possess legal authorization to work for any employer in the United States, and the employer cannot provide sponsorship or take over sponsorship of an employment visa at this time.
  • BS or MS degree in Electronic Mechanical, Electrical or related engineering field.

  • Must be willing to work a graveyard shift.

  • 2+ years’ experience with AMAT xR/Quantum, ViiSion80 High Current Implanters, or Axcelis High Energy Implanters.

  • Demonstrate basic electrical and mechanical troubleshooting skills.

  • Able to use electronic and/or test equipment.

  • Able to use tool manuals and follow established processes and procedures.
